Athens Borough man convicted on drug charges

A jury found an Athens Borough man guilty of several drug charges in Bradford County Court last week.

According to court documents, 53-year-old David William Wright was convicted of felony manufacture, delivery or possession with intent to manufacture or deliver and possession of  a controlled substance.

Wright was arrested after he sold meth to a confidential informant at his home in Athens Borough last year.

The investigation was conducted by the Bradford County Drug Task Force and Pennsylvania State Police Vice and Narcotics Unit.
